In today’s digital landscape, where data breaches and cyber attacks are becoming increasingly common, ensuring the security of our passwords has never been more crucial. With the advancements in artificial intelligence (AI) technology, organizations are now able to leverage sophisticated algorithms and machine learning to keep passwords safe and sound. But how exactly does AI contribute to password protection? How can it detect and prevent unauthorized access? And what does the future hold for password security in the age of AI? Let’s explore these questions and delve into the world of AI-powered password safeguarding to understand how it can enhance our digital security.
Key Takeaways
- Password security is crucial in protecting sensitive information from unauthorized access.
- AI technology is used for both password recovery and password cracking.
- Advanced algorithms, such as encryption techniques and multi-factor authentication, enhance password security.
- Machine learning algorithms strengthen password safeguarding and help detect and prevent unauthorized access.
The Importance of Password Security
Ensuring robust password security is paramount in safeguarding sensitive information from unauthorized access. With the increasing prevalence of cyberattacks, organizations and individuals must be proactive in protecting their data. Password cracking techniques have become more sophisticated, making it crucial to implement strong password security measures.
One key aspect of password security is password strength assessment. The strength of a password refers to its ability to withstand attempts at unauthorized access. Assessing the strength of a password involves evaluating various factors, such as length, complexity, and uniqueness. A strong password typically consists of a combination of uppercase and lowercase letters, numbers, and special characters. It should also be at least eight characters long and avoid common words or patterns.
Password cracking techniques employ various methods to guess or decrypt passwords. These techniques include brute-force attacks, dictionary attacks, and rainbow table attacks. Brute-force attacks involve systematically trying every possible combination of characters until the correct password is found. Dictionary attacks use pre-generated lists of common passwords or words. Rainbow table attacks utilize precomputed tables to quickly find password matches.
AI Technology for Password Protection
With the increasing sophistication of password cracking techniques, the need for advanced AI technology to enhance password protection has become imperative. AI technology has proven to be a valuable tool in both password recovery and password cracking.
AI technology for password recovery involves using machine learning algorithms to analyze patterns and identify potential passwords based on known data. By examining a user’s previous passwords, AI algorithms can generate a list of likely password combinations, making it easier for users to regain access to their accounts if they forget their passwords.
On the other hand, AI technology for password cracking is used by cybercriminals to exploit vulnerabilities and break into secure systems. These AI-powered tools leverage deep learning algorithms to quickly and efficiently guess passwords by analyzing patterns, common password combinations, and previously breached passwords.
To combat the growing threat of password cracking, AI technology is also being utilized in password protection. AI algorithms can detect suspicious login attempts and flag them for further investigation, as well as implement multi-factor authentication and adaptive authentication techniques to strengthen security measures.
Advanced Algorithms for Enhanced Security
To ensure enhanced security for passwords, advanced algorithms play a crucial role. Robust encryption techniques are employed to protect sensitive data from unauthorized access. Additionally, multi-factor authentication adds an extra layer of security by requiring multiple forms of identification before granting access to accounts or systems.
Robust Encryption Techniques
Using advanced algorithms, robust encryption techniques provide enhanced security for protecting sensitive information. Encryption algorithms play a crucial role in ensuring data privacy by transforming plaintext into ciphertext, making it unreadable to unauthorized individuals. These algorithms employ complex mathematical functions, such as symmetric and asymmetric encryption, to encrypt and decrypt data securely. Symmetric encryption uses a single key for both encryption and decryption, while asymmetric encryption uses a pair of keys, one for encryption and the other for decryption. This dual-key system enhances security and enables secure communication over insecure channels. To prevent password cracking techniques, encryption techniques such as hashing and salting are employed. Hashing converts passwords into fixed-length strings, while salting adds a unique random value to each password, making it difficult for attackers to crack passwords using precomputed tables or rainbow tables. By employing robust encryption techniques, organizations can ensure the confidentiality and integrity of their sensitive data.
Multi-Factor Authentication
Multi-Factor Authentication employs advanced algorithms to enhance security and safeguard sensitive information. This authentication method adds an extra layer of protection by requiring users to provide multiple forms of identification before granting access to a system or application. One of the key advancements in Multi-Factor Authentication is the integration of AI-powered authentication and biometric identification. AI algorithms analyze biometric data, such as fingerprints, facial features, or voice patterns, to ensure the authenticity of the user. This approach significantly reduces the risk of identity theft and unauthorized access. By combining something the user knows (like a password), something the user has (like a fingerprint or a smart card), and something the user is (like a unique biometric characteristic), Multi-Factor Authentication provides a robust and reliable security solution for protecting sensitive information in today’s digital landscape.
Machine Learning in Password Safeguarding
Machine learning techniques offer a highly effective approach to enhancing password safeguarding. With the increasing prevalence of cyber threats, it is essential to develop robust security measures to protect user data. Machine learning algorithms can analyze vast amounts of data and identify patterns and anomalies that may indicate potential security breaches. By leveraging this technology, password safeguarding can be significantly strengthened.
One of the key advantages of machine learning in password safeguarding is improving the user experience. Traditional password systems often require users to create complex passwords, which can be difficult to remember. Machine learning algorithms can analyze user behavior patterns and preferences to generate personalized password recommendations that are both strong and memorable. This not only enhances security but also simplifies the user experience, reducing the burden of remembering multiple complex passwords.
However, it is important to consider ethical considerations when implementing machine learning in password safeguarding. Privacy concerns arise when user data is collected and analyzed to develop personalized password recommendations. It is crucial to ensure that user consent is obtained and that data is handled in a secure and responsible manner.
To enhance security measures, it is crucial to implement robust systems for detecting and preventing unauthorized access. With the increasing sophistication of cyber threats, organizations need effective mechanisms to identify and respond to unauthorized activities in real-time. Artificial intelligence (AI) plays a vital role in this endeavor by continuously monitoring network traffic, user behavior, and system logs to detect any suspicious or abnormal activities.
By leveraging AI algorithms, organizations can analyze vast amounts of data and identify patterns indicative of unauthorized access attempts. Machine learning algorithms can learn from historical data and detect anomalies or deviations from normal behavior, helping to flag potential security breaches. These advanced algorithms can also adapt and evolve over time to stay ahead of evolving threats.
Preventing data breaches is equally important. AI can help in this aspect by proactively identifying vulnerabilities in a system and implementing necessary security measures. For example, AI can automatically update software and patch vulnerabilities, reducing the risk of exploitation by hackers. Additionally, AI-powered authentication systems can strengthen access controls and ensure that only authorized users can access sensitive data.
Securing Passwords in the Digital Age
In the digital age, securing passwords has become increasingly important. Password encryption techniques play a crucial role in protecting sensitive information from unauthorized access. Additionally, two-factor authentication methods provide an extra layer of security by requiring users to provide two forms of identification. Furthermore, password manager applications offer a convenient solution for generating and storing complex passwords securely.
Password Encryption Techniques
With the rapid advancement of technology in the digital age, ensuring the security of passwords has become a paramount concern, leading to the development and implementation of robust password encryption techniques. To safeguard passwords effectively, several encryption methods are commonly used:
- Hashing: This technique involves converting a password into a fixed-length string of characters using a mathematical algorithm. The resulting hash value is stored in the system instead of the actual password.
- Salted Hashing: To further enhance security, a random value called a "salt" is added to the password before hashing. This prevents attackers from using precomputed tables to crack passwords.
- Key Derivation Functions (KDFs): KDFs apply complex mathematical operations to passwords, making them more resistant to password cracking techniques.
Additionally, password encryption techniques can be strengthened by incorporating biometric authentication, such as fingerprints or facial recognition, to provide an extra layer of security.
Two-Factor Authentication Methods
As technology continues to advance in the digital age, the implementation of robust two-factor authentication methods has become crucial in securing passwords and protecting sensitive information. Two-factor authentication adds an extra layer of security by requiring users to provide two different types of authentication credentials. One popular method is biometric authentication, which uses unique physical or behavioral characteristics such as fingerprints, facial recognition, or voice recognition to verify a user’s identity. This method offers a high level of security as biometric information is difficult to replicate. Another common method is the use of hardware tokens, which are physical devices that generate one-time passwords or codes. These tokens provide an additional layer of security by ensuring that only authorized individuals with the physical token can access the account or system. By incorporating biometric authentication and hardware tokens into the authentication process, organizations can significantly enhance the security of their systems and protect sensitive information from unauthorized access.
Password Manager Applications
Password Manager applications play a crucial role in securing passwords and ensuring the safety of sensitive information in the digital age. These applications offer a range of features that make password management easier and more secure. Some of the key benefits of using password managers include:
- Strong Password Generation: Password managers can generate complex and unique passwords for each online account, eliminating the need to remember multiple passwords.
- Secure Storage: Password managers store passwords in an encrypted format, protecting them from unauthorized access.
- Auto-Fill Functionality: Password managers can automatically fill in login credentials, saving time and reducing the risk of phishing attacks.
AI Solutions for Stronger Passwords
AI solutions offer a robust approach to enhancing password security. By leveraging artificial intelligence technologies, organizations can implement advanced measures to protect sensitive information from unauthorized access. Two key AI solutions for stronger passwords are AI-driven password generators and AI-powered biometric authentication.
AI-driven password generators use machine learning algorithms to generate complex and unique passwords for individuals. These algorithms analyze patterns and structures in existing passwords to create strong and unpredictable combinations. By creating passwords that are difficult to guess or crack, AI-driven password generators significantly improve the security of user accounts.
On the other hand, AI-powered biometric authentication utilizes machine learning algorithms to verify an individual’s identity based on their unique biological characteristics. This technology replaces traditional password-based authentication methods with more secure and convenient alternatives such as fingerprint recognition, facial recognition, or voice recognition. AI algorithms learn and adapt to each individual’s biometric features, making authentication more accurate and reliable.
The following table provides a comparison of the benefits and features of AI-driven password generators and AI-powered biometric authentication:
AI-Driven Password Generators | AI-Powered Biometric Authentication |
---|---|
Generates complex and unique passwords | Replaces password-based authentication |
Improves security by creating strong passwords | Verifies identity based on biometric data |
Reduces the risk of password-related breaches | Offers convenience and ease of use |
Enhancing Password Security With AI
Implementing artificial intelligence technology is an effective approach to bolstering password security and safeguarding sensitive information from unauthorized access. AI-powered password managers and AI-driven password cracking algorithms are two key areas where AI is enhancing password security. Here are three ways AI is enhancing password security:
AI-powered password managers: AI can assist in generating and managing strong, unique passwords for each online account. Password managers use AI algorithms to analyze patterns and suggest complex passwords that are difficult to crack. Additionally, AI can detect and alert users about potential security breaches, such as reused or weak passwords.
AI-driven password cracking algorithms: Hackers are constantly evolving their techniques to crack passwords. AI-driven password cracking algorithms can help organizations stay one step ahead by identifying patterns and vulnerabilities in password structures. By leveraging AI, organizations can proactively identify weak passwords and enforce stronger security measures.
Behavioral biometrics: AI can analyze user behavior patterns, such as typing speed, mouse movements, and touchscreen gestures, to create a unique behavioral biometric profile. This profile can be used to authenticate users and detect any suspicious activity. AI algorithms can continuously learn and adapt to changes in user behavior, providing an additional layer of security.
Future of Password Protection With AI
The advancement of artificial intelligence technology is shaping the future of password protection, revolutionizing the way sensitive information is safeguarded. One of the key areas where AI is expected to have a significant impact is in biometric authentication for password protection. Biometric authentication involves using unique physical or behavioral characteristics, such as fingerprints, iris scans, or facial recognition, to verify a user’s identity. Unlike traditional passwords, biometric authentication is much harder to replicate or steal, providing a higher level of security.
AI is also playing a vital role in detecting and preventing phishing attacks, which are one of the most common methods used by hackers to steal passwords and gain unauthorized access to sensitive information. By analyzing patterns, AI algorithms can identify suspicious emails, websites, or links that may be part of a phishing attack. This allows AI-powered systems to alert users and prevent them from falling victim to phishing attempts.
In the future, AI is expected to further enhance password protection by continuously learning and adapting to new threats. AI algorithms can analyze vast amounts of data, identify patterns, and detect emerging threats in real-time. This proactive approach to security will help prevent potential breaches and keep sensitive information safe and secure. With the rapid advancements in AI technology, the future of password protection looks promising, providing a robust defense against unauthorized access and cyber threats.
Frequently Asked Questions
How Does AI Technology for Password Protection Work?
AI technology for password protection works by using advanced algorithms and machine learning techniques to enhance cybersecurity measures. It analyzes user behavior, patterns, and biometric data to detect anomalies and identify potential security threats. By doing so, AI can help in identifying weak passwords, detecting unauthorized access attempts, and providing personalized security recommendations. This technology offers several advantages in password protection, including increased accuracy, real-time threat detection, and improved user experience. Overall, AI has a significant impact on strengthening cybersecurity measures and ensuring passwords remain safe and secure.
What Are Some Examples of Advanced Algorithms Used for Enhanced Password Security?
Biometric authentication and two-factor authentication are examples of advanced algorithms used for enhanced password security. Biometric authentication involves using unique physical or behavioral characteristics, such as fingerprints or facial recognition, to verify a user’s identity. Two-factor authentication adds an extra layer of security by requiring users to provide two different types of authentication, such as a password and a unique code sent to their mobile device. These algorithms help protect against unauthorized access and enhance password security.
How Does Machine Learning Play a Role in Password Safeguarding?
Machine learning plays a crucial role in password safeguarding by leveraging advanced algorithms to enhance security measures. Through AI’s impact on password encryption, it can analyze patterns and behaviors, identifying potential vulnerabilities and developing secure password policies. By continuously learning from data, AI can adapt to emerging threats, improving the overall protection of passwords. This allows for more robust and reliable security measures, ensuring that passwords remain safe and sound from unauthorized access.
AI plays a crucial role in detecting and preventing unauthorized access to passwords by leveraging its ability to analyze user behavior patterns. AI-powered password managers utilize machine learning algorithms to continuously learn and adapt to user preferences and behaviors. By monitoring login attempts, detecting suspicious activities, and implementing advanced authentication methods, AI can identify and block unauthorized access attempts. This proactive approach helps ensure the security and integrity of passwords, providing users with a robust defense against potential threats.
What Are Some Potential Future Advancements in Password Protection Using AI Technology?
Potential future advancements in password protection using AI technology include the integration of biometric authentication methods and the development of AI-powered password managers. Biometric authentication, such as fingerprint or facial recognition, offers a more secure and convenient way to authenticate users. AI-powered password managers can use machine learning algorithms to detect and prevent unauthorized access, provide personalized password recommendations, and identify potential security vulnerabilities. These advancements have the potential to enhance the security and usability of password protection systems in the future.
Conclusion
In conclusion, AI technology offers advanced algorithms and machine learning capabilities that greatly enhance password security. By detecting and preventing unauthorized access, AI solutions provide a valuable defense against cyber threats in the digital age. With the use of AI, passwords can be safeguarded more effectively, ensuring the safety and integrity of sensitive information. As the future of password protection continues to evolve, AI will undoubtedly play a crucial role in strengthening security measures.